ABC Motsepe National Play Offs

The ABC Motsepe National Play Offs marks the end of the SAFA ABC Motsepe League season which currently operates as the overall third tier of South African football. During it’s season, the league features 144 teams which are divided into nine divisions located within the nine geo-political provinces of South Africa.

The winner of each provincial division comprising of 16 teams advances to the ABC Motsepe National Play Offs to compete for the two available spots in the National First Division.

The public draw of the ABC Motsepe National Play Offs is conducted by SAFA and the ABC Motsepe foundation to determine the two groups and fixtures which are played over a week-long period.

The top two finishers from the two groups advance to the finals and gain automatic promotion to the National First Division (NFD). Winners of the finals walk away with R1-Million with the losing finalists receiving R500 000.
